Customers, neighbors wonder about Pages' future
SAVOY – Pages for All Ages bookstore at Savoy Plaza has been closed since midweek, and customers and neighboring business owners are wondering if it will reopen.
A sign on the front doors states the store is closed for inventory. The store was locked up and dark Friday, and calls to the store were answered with a recording stating that all lines are busy.
Store owners Brandon and Susan Griffing couldn't be reached for comment.
Julie Clayton, director of administration for Savoy Plaza's owner, Evansville, Ind.-based Regency Properties, said she wasn't aware of any plans to close the store.
Savoy Village Manager Dick Helton said Friday the Griffings hadn't told village officials anything about closing the store.
"We know there's a sign on the store that says they're closed for taking inventory," he added.
